The Advantages of Using a Lithium Battery with the Lento 2KVA Inverter

When combined with a lithium battery, the Lento 2KVA inverter offers several advantages over traditional inverter systems that use lead-acid batteries:

  1. Faster Charging: Lithium batteries charge faster than their lead-acid counterparts. This means that during periods of intermittent power supply, the battery can recharge quickly, ensuring that it is ready to provide backup power when needed.
  2. Longer Lifespan: Lithium batteries have a much longer lifespan compared to lead-acid batteries. On average, a lithium battery can last up to 10 years, while lead-acid batteries need to be replaced every 3-5 years. This makes lithium batteries a more cost-effective choice in the long run.
  3. Higher Efficiency: Lithium batteries are more efficient in storing and discharging energy. They can deliver almost 100% of their stored power, whereas lead-acid batteries typically only discharge about 50-70% of their capacity.
  4. Maintenance-Free: Unlike lead-acid batteries, which require regular maintenance such as topping up with distilled water, lithium batteries are maintenance-free. This reduces the hassle for users and ensures a more convenient and worry-free experience.
  5. Compact and Lightweight: Lithium batteries are much lighter and more compact than lead-acid batteries, making them easier to install and transport. This is particularly beneficial for households with limited space or those looking for a more aesthetically pleasing solution.
  6. Environmentally Friendly: Lithium batteries are more eco-friendly than lead-acid batteries because they do not emit harmful gases or require the use of hazardous chemicals for maintenance. Additionally, they are recyclable, contributing to a more sustainable environment.

Q. How to calculate how long an inverter battery will last?

A. How to calculate how long a battery will last on an inverter? If it is a 12 Volt battery system, all you do is multiply the usable Ah of your battery by 12 to find its watt-hours and then divide the watt-hours by the load's required watts (or your power consumption rate) to calculate the total run-time.

Q. How to calculate lithium battery run time?

A. The calculator applies the formula: Capacity (Ah) x Voltage (V) x Efficiency / Load Power (W). This equation gives an estimated runtime based on the input values. For instance, a 100 Ah battery at 12V with 90% efficiency powering a 50W load would have a runtime of (100 Ah x 12V x 0.9) / 50W = 21.6 hours.

Q. How much load can a 2KVA inverter take?

A. A 2KVA inverter can typically handle a load of up to 1600 watts, with an efficiency of around 80%. This makes it suitable for running multiple household appliances such as lights, fans, a television, and even a refrigerator.
